WebbMany of the children who have anxiety or symptoms of OCD also experiences tics. In fact, studies have found that as many as 50-85% of children with Tourette Syndrome (TS) also meet criteria for OCD. Common tics include eye-blinking, facial grimacing, nose scrunching, touching and clapping. Vocal tics include humming, throat clearing and ... Webb14 juni 2024 · Motor tics include movements such as blinking, head turning, head nodding, kicking, mouth pouting, mouth opening, mouth twitches, etc. Vocal tics include things such as throat clearing, coughing, sniffing, yelling, or making animal sounds. Tics occur very commonly in children who do not have Tourette's syndrome. switch to coinbase pro

Webb18 sep. 2024 · Habit reversal training is a therapy that can be effective in treating troublesome behaviors caused by a number of conditions. One of these is Tourette's syndrome, which is characterized by physical or verbal tics, such as blinking, throat clearing, repeating obscenities.
